Foundational Skills for Success
To excel in predictive modeling and data mining, individuals must possess a combination of technical, business, and soft skills. From a technical standpoint, proficiency in programming languages such as Python, R, or SQL is essential, as well as familiarity with data visualization tools and machine learning algorithms. Additionally, a strong understanding of statistical concepts, data structures, and data preprocessing techniques is vital. However, technical expertise alone is not sufficient; professionals must also demonstrate business acumen, including the ability to communicate complex insights to stakeholders, identify business problems, and develop effective solutions. Furthermore, soft skills like collaboration, time management, and continuous learning are crucial in a field where technologies and methodologies are constantly evolving.
Best Practices for Predictive Modeling and Data Mining
To maximize the potential of predictive modeling and data mining, professionals must adhere to best practices that ensure the quality, accuracy, and reliability of their models. This includes careful data selection and preprocessing, feature engineering, and model evaluation using metrics such as accuracy, precision, and recall. Moreover, it is essential to consider the ethical implications of predictive modeling, including issues related to data privacy, bias, and transparency. By prioritizing these best practices, professionals can develop robust and dependable models that drive meaningful business outcomes. Another critical aspect is the ability to tell a story with data, presenting complex findings in a clear and concise manner that resonates with stakeholders and informs strategic decision-making.
